Don Moxham Sr.

May 16, 1928 - April 18, 2013


With children Carrie, Dixie, and Donnie; sister Dorothy and nephew Garry at his side Don passed away while his airplane stories were being told. Don loved to be surrounded by people, whether it was getting together to sing and play the guitar, tell stories and jokes, talk on the ham radio air waves or at the Stettler Flying Club where he was a long time member and avid pilot. Don's passion for cars lead him to open Alberta's second Datsun dealership, a business known today as Don's Car Sales now owned by son Donnie and son-in-law Alvin. Raised north of Red Willow, he then resided in Stettler and retired to Rochon Sands.

Dad has shown us perseverance and courage as the once lively, humorous yet compassionate entertainer, retired businessman, and father was silenced with a massive stroke 14 years ago.

Predeceased by wife Barbara 10 years ago, sister Dorothy Fix's husband Charlie and sister-in-law Jean Macleod, Dad is also now free and with them and so many friends.

A special thanks goes out to a very dedicated friend, John Wittwer, who visited Dad twice a week for these past 14 years. The family also wants to thank all the support from so many of the health care staff who have been such a help with all the challenges over the years. Your compassion and support is overwhelming. For those who wish, the family wishes to acknowledge a truly amazing facility who went above and beyond in helping us with Dad's challenges, memorial donations may be made in Don's name to County of Stettler Housing Authority - Willow Creek (or a charity of choice). Most gracious thanks for everyone's support!

On April 22, 2013 Reverend Jerry deVries and Stettler Funeral Home helped the family and friends celebrate Don's life. Love you Dad and Grampa!

Survived by his loving family: Carrie (Alvin) Kuefer - Erin (Kurt) Chick, Bethany; Dixie (Brian) Hawkins - Chris, Janine; Donnie (Kathy) Moxham - Scott; sister Dorothy Fix; brother in law Jack Macleod (Lenora); other family and many dear friends.
